Episode 1: Property Risk
With the average large fire now costing almost £1m to rectify – it really is so important to take simple risk control measures to minimise the potential risk of a fire.
We discuss the changes to the built environment and how these new ways of working can do wonders for the sustainability agenda, but still need to be considered from a fire risk perspective. Maintenance of your properties can really make a difference to how susceptible your buildings are to fire so we share some risk control measures to help. With an increase in the number of vacant buildings due to the economic climate we also explore what you can do to keep your empty properties safe.
